OpenMythos/open_mythos/__init__.py
Kye Gomez 12f6c5b32e [docs][readme-badges][add pypi twitter github badges to
readme][improvement][init-sort][sort imports alphabetically in
  init][improvement][version-bump][bump version to
  0.3.0][feat][tokenizer-class][add MythosTokenizer to init
  exports][feat][test-tokenizer][add tokenizer test suite with printed output]
2026-04-19 23:18:05 -04:00

56 lines
1002 B
Python

from open_mythos.main import (
ACTHalting,
Expert,
GQAttention,
LoRAAdapter,
LTIInjection,
MLAttention,
MoEFFN,
MythosConfig,
OpenMythos,
RecurrentBlock,
RMSNorm,
TransformerBlock,
apply_rope,
loop_index_embedding,
precompute_rope_freqs,
)
from open_mythos.tokenizer import MythosTokenizer
from open_mythos.variants import (
mythos_1b,
mythos_1t,
mythos_3b,
mythos_10b,
mythos_50b,
mythos_100b,
mythos_500b,
)
__all__ = [
"MythosConfig",
"RMSNorm",
"GQAttention",
"MLAttention",
"Expert",
"MoEFFN",
"LoRAAdapter",
"TransformerBlock",
"LTIInjection",
"ACTHalting",
"RecurrentBlock",
"OpenMythos",
"precompute_rope_freqs",
"apply_rope",
"loop_index_embedding",
"mythos_1b",
"mythos_3b",
"mythos_10b",
"mythos_50b",
"mythos_100b",
"mythos_500b",
"mythos_1t",
"load_tokenizer",
"get_vocab_size",
"MythosTokenizer",
]